What Is Hip? (Little Big Band)arr. Mike
Tomaro. Here is a signature tune from the definitive
funk band, Tower of Power. Scored for just six
horns (3 saxes, 2 trumpets, 1 trombone) and
rhythm section, this dynamic and authentic chart
offers your band a challenge that is worth the extra
effort. Optional parts are included for alto sax, tenor
sax and trombone 2. Highly recommended!

n What You Dealin' With?Wycliffe Gordon. This
is the show closer that will bring down the house!
The main groove is a funky boogaloo at about 103
bpm, plus a band chant, a swing section, and a
gospel feel. Flexible solo space with written solos
is provided for trombone 1, alto, tenor, and trumpet
2, and the lead trumpet range is to high C. Hey,
there's something here for everyone!

n WhiplashHank Levy/arr. Erik Morales.
Featured in the 2014 movie "Whiplash," depicting
the relationship between an ambitious student
musician and an abusive, yet respected instructor,
this chart is a super-exciting work in 7/4 composed
by Hank Levy and arranged by Erik Morales. Don't
be intimidated by the meter... it's challenging, but
after a few minutes it feels quite natural and the
students will totally groove on it. The melody is
stated by 2nd trumpet and 1st alto with solo space
for both on easy chord changes. Articulation is
critical and the rhythm section may want to spend
some quality time together. The lead trumpet range
is to written D above the staff. This is a unique but
very desirable chart to have in your library. You
won't regret playing Whiplash!
